How to Use a Projector with Your iPhone 5

The iPhone 5 may be an older model, but it still offers a wide array of features that make it a versatile device. One such feature is its ability to connect to a projector, allowing you to share your photos, videos, and presentations with a larger audience. In this article, well look at how to work a projector with an iPhone 5.

Step 1: Check Your Connections

To connect your iPhone 5 to a projector, youll need an adapter that allows you to use an HDMI or VGA cable. Apple offers two types of adapters: a Lightning Digital AV Adapter (which connects to an HDMI cable) and a Lightning to VGA Adapter (which connects to a VGA cable). Make sure you have the correct adapter for your projector.

Step 2: Connect Your iPhone 5 to the Adapter

Connect your iPhone 5 to the adapter using the Lightning connector. Make sure the adapter is securely plugged into your iPhone.

Step 3: Connect the Adapter to the Projector

Connect the adapter to your projector using the HDMI or VGA cable. Make sure the cable is securely plugged into the adapter and the projector.

Step 4: Select the Input

Using the remote or on-screen display of your projector, select the input source that corresponds to the HDMI or VGA port you plugged the adapter into.

Step 5: Mirror Your iPhone 5 Screen

Once your iPhone 5 is connected to the adapter and the adapter is connected to the projector, your iPhone 5 screen should be mirrored on the projector screen. If its not, go to the Settings app on your iPhone, select Display & Brightness, then select Screen Mirroring. Make sure your projector is selected as the device to mirror to.

Do I Need a FiOS Box for Every TV?

If you are a subscriber to Verizon FiOS, you may be wondering whether you need a FiOS box for every TV in your home. The answer to this question depends on a variety of factors, including the number of TVs you have, the type of FiOS service you are using, and your personal preferences for TV viewing.

Lets start with the basics. Verizon FiOS is a fiber-optic service that delivers television programming, high-speed Internet, and phone service to homes and businesses. If you are a FiOS TV subscriber, you will need a FiOS set-top box (STB) to receive and decode the TV signal.

So the question becomes: Do you need a separate FiOS STB for every TV in your home? The answer is, it depends. If you have one TV in your home and you only want to watch the basic channels that come with your FiOS TV service, you may be able to simply connect your TV to the FiOS outlet and receive a signal without a separate STB.

However, if you have multiple TVs in your home or you want to access premium channels or other advanced TV features, you will need a separate FiOS STB for each TV. Verizon offers a variety of STBs to choose from, including standard-definition (SD) and high-definition (HD) models, as well as DVRs that allow you to record and pause live TV.
